Output ad3a390199461e66f3ac674a14686450c663936eb2fbe3c1fe4d214c764fa34e:1

value
850800
script pubkey
OP_0 OP_PUSHBYTES_20 3e968da91066f04e8d10193e89fbc6a7f7917e70
address
bc1q86tgm2gsvmcyargsrylgn77x5lmezlnsr0a66w
transaction
ad3a390199461e66f3ac674a14686450c663936eb2fbe3c1fe4d214c764fa34e
confirmations
366648
spent
true